Web[Texas Labor Code §§408.101 – 408.105, 28 Texas Administrative Code §§129.1 – 129.11] You may be paid TIBs if your work-related injury or illness causes you to lose all or some of your wages for . more than seven (7) days. Maximum medical improvement (MMI) and impairment rating (IR) WebStatutory MMI is the later of: (1) the end of the 104th week after the date that temporary income benefits (TIBs) began to accrue; or (2) the date to which MMI was extended by the commission through operation of Texas Labor Code § 408.104 .

WebMaximum Medical Improvement (MMI) is the technical term which basically means “as good as you’re going to get”.
